Gefiltert nach Kategorie Accessibility Filter zurücksetzen

Vortrag über barrierefreie Webentwicklung auf dem IKT Forum an der Uni Linz

11. Juli 2012, Felix Nagel - jQuery, Accessibility, Studium

© Kompetenznetzwerk KI-I

Am 9. und 10. Juli fand an der Johannes Kepler Universität in Linz das IKT Forum statt. Die jährlich im Vorfeld der icchp stattfindende Veranstaltung dreht sich rund um Barrierefreiheit, unter anderem auch um Barrierefreiheit im Internet.

 

Ausschnitt aus der Beschreibung des Veranstalters, des Kompetenznetzwerk KI-I:

Im Kontext der Barrierefreiheit bietet das IKT-Forum Information und Austausch insbesondere zwischen Personen mit/ohne Beeinträchtigungen aus Theorie und Praxis, Personen aus der Wissenschaft und Entwicklung, Personen aus Betreuungsberufen sowie pädagogischen Berufen. Das IKT-Forum ist damit seit langem Ideen- und Innovationsbörse im Bereich barrierefreier IKT für Menschen mit Beeinträchtigungen.

 

 

Im Track "Barrierefreies Webdesign" habe ich am Montag Vormittag einen Vortrag über moderne, Java-Scipt gestützte Webapplikationen gehalten. Angelehnt an meine Diplomarbeit habe ich versucht einen Einblick in die Problematik bei der Implementierung von Barrierefreiheit in moderne Userinterfaces zu geben. Damit die Praxis nicht zu kurz kommt habe ich außerdem meine jQuery Accessible-RIA Widgets vorgestellt.

 

Die Vorbereitung hat einige Mühe gemacht und die Anfahrt war nicht gerade kurz -- und trotzdem hat es sich in jedem Fall gelohnt. Die Organisation war super, es gab interessante Diskussionen und viele neue Informationen. Vielen Dank für die Einladung!

Vortrag über barrierefreie Webentwicklung auf dem IKT Forum an der Uni Linz

jQuery ARIA with browser history support: tabs, lightbox and sortable tables

06. Juni 2010, Felix Nagel - English, jQuery, Accessibility, Open Source

© jQuey Logo: The jQuery Project

A few month ago I received some requests about adding browser history support and browser title support to my jQuery ARIA widgets. As this would be nice feature for both, usability and accessibility, I allocated some time to get this done.

jQuery ARIA with browser history support: tabs, lightbox and sortable tables

jQuery Accessible Rich Internet Applications jetzt für jQuery 1.4 und UI 1.8

22. April 2010, Felix Nagel - jQuery, Accessibility, Open Source

© jQuey Logo: The jQuery Project

Schon seit einigen Monaten steht fest das mit der neuen Version des Java-Script Frameworks jQuery und dessen Widget Palette jQuery UI einige Anpassungen an eigenen Scripten erfolgen muss.

Mit dem final Release von Version jQuery 1.4.2 und UI 1.8 habe ich endlich das Ergebnis meiner Diplomarbeit modifiziert.

 

 

Im folgenden ein kleiner Erfahrungsbericht vom Upgrade auf jQuery 1.4.2 und jQuery UI 1.8. Die Links dürften gut als Tutorial dienen.

 

jQuery Accessible Rich Internet Applications jetzt für jQuery 1.4 und UI 1.8

TYPO3 reCaptcha Extension ohne JavaScript

07. Januar 2010, Felix Nagel - Accessibility, TYPO3

© TYPO3 Association , typo.org

Die reCaptcha Extension für TYPO3,  jm_ reCaptcha, hat leider keinen noscript Tag der das Ausfüllen bei Abgeschaltetem JavaScript ermöglicht.  Gemäß der Spezifikation von reCaptcha habe ich diese hinzugefügt. Das ganze ist noch ohne LL VAriablen aber ich habe den Bug / das Feature an die Entwickler weitergeleitet und hoffe es wird bald eingebaut.

TYPO3 reCaptcha Extension ohne JavaScript

Barrierefreie, sortierbare Tabellen mit jQuery

10. Dezember 2009, Felix Nagel - jQuery, Accessibility, Open Source, Studium

© jQuey Logo: The jQuery Project

Im vorerst letzten Blogpost, zu den während meiner Diplomarbeit bei Namics entstandenen  jQuery Accessible Rich Internet Appllications, stelle ich sortierbare Tabellen vor. Mit dem Widget lassen sich standardkonforme HTML Tabellen sehr einfach um einige nützliche Funktionen erweitern oder man nutzt es als Grundlage komplexer Anwendungen in denen tabellarisch Daten dargestellt werden.

Barrierefreie, sortierbare Tabellen mit jQuery

jQuery UI Tabs made accessible

29. November 2009, Felix Nagel - jQuery, Accessibility, Open Source, Studium

© jQuey Logo: The jQuery Project

Zeit für Post 3 in meiner Reihe über jQuery Accessible Rich Internet Applications im Zuge meiner Diplomarbeit: Accessible Tabs

 

jQuery UI stellt bereits ein sehr mächtiges UI Widget für Tabs zur Verfügung und so war für mich schnell klar das ich dieses erweitern und verbessern will. Nachdem ich verschiedene Methoden zur Erweiterung vorhandener Klassen in jQuery durch hatte und diese alle nicht hinnehmbare Probleme mit sich brachten, entschied ich mich dafür relativ schlicht die Funktionen zu überschreiben und die Originalmethoden vor meinen Änderungen aufzurufen.

jQuery UI Tabs made accessible

Barrierefreie jQuery Lightbox nach WAI ARIA und WCAG 2.0

23. November 2009, Felix Nagel - jQuery, Accessibility, Open Source, Studium

© jQuey Logo: The jQuery Project

Im zweiten Teil meiner kleinen Reihe geht es um einen, mittlwerweile, alten Bekannten: die Lightbox. Ich stelle hier meine barrierefreie Variante auf Basis der jQuery UI Widget Factory vor, die im Rahmen meiner Diplomarbeit bei der Firma Namics entstand.

 

Achtung: Diese Anleitung bezieht sich auf die jQuery 1.3.x bzw. jQuery UI 1.8.x Variante meines Scripts. Im Gallerie-Modus sind jetzt geringfügige Änderungen nötig.

 

Barrierefreie jQuery Lightbox nach WAI ARIA und WCAG 2.0

Barrierefreie Live Validierung von Formularen mit jQuery

16. November 2009, Felix Nagel - jQuery, Accessibility, Open Source, Studium

© jQuey Logo: The jQuery Project

Im Zuge meiner Diplomarbeit bei der Full Service Internetagentur Namics habe ich einige barrierefreie Applikationenhttp://jqueryui.com/ für jQuery entwickelt die den Richtlinien der W3C WCAG 2.0 und ARIA entsprechen.

Eine theoretische Ausarbeitung zur Entwicklung dieser Applikationen und der dazugehörigen Theorie findet ihr in meiner Diplomarbeit. Die dort enthaltenen Hintergrundinfos können wertvolle Argumentationshilfen sein.

 

Die 4 Widgets (Live Validierung, Lightbox, Tabs, sortierbare Tabellen) werde ich in diesem und folgenden Posts vorstellen. Den Anfang macht die Live Formular Validierung.

Barrierefreie Live Validierung von Formularen mit jQuery